Remember the Goodreads fanfic debaucle? Well, another site is now doing it. I just found 13 of my stories listed over on ebooks-tree.com, a for-profit site where I neither uploaded them nor authorized anyone else to do so.
I have a very clear statement that says I do not want my works or translations published on any platform other than AO3, for various reasons, yet this seems to have been completely ignored.
They make revenue off your work via ads and if you want to see any reviews which have been left on it, they want you to create an account with TzarMedia for access.
“Access Required.You need to create an account to gain permission to access unlimited downloads & streaming.“
“Take advantage of our special promotional offer to gain unlimited access for 5 days for free.”
Which, gee, that last line sounds like they’re charging for access to your works, too.
If you write fanfic, please check the site for your own works, Google for your name and the ebooks-tree site.
I just wrote them a letter requesting that they be removed. I guess we’ll see what happens.

This is a copy of the letter I emailed my MP:
Hello,
I’m writing once agin as a concerned member of the LGBT community, this time to raise your awareness of the impending deportation of a Nigerian LGBT activist called Aderonke Apata, as someone who lives in Britain and enjoys the freedom against discrimination, I am disheartened that others are not extended the same safety.
If you read this article and several others, they report that she is said to not be a lesbian because she has a daughter and has had relationships with men/a man in the past. This is an extremely outdated and offensive view. Many gay and lesbian people especially in countries that are highly homophobic are subjected to Compulsory Heterosexuality which in brief forces a lot of us to engage in heterosexual relationships to deny our sexuality and fit in with society. Even Elton John married a woman, and I doubt anyone would call into question the validity of his sexuality.
I do hope you can help to shed some light on the situation, as well as help advocte for a valued member of the LGBT community.
Your Constituent, [redacted].
